Barista in Bayonne, NJ
Baristas in Bayonne, NJ, in 2026, earn approximately $14.23 per hour, which translates to about $569.20 per week, $2,466.53 per month, and $29,598.40 per year.
The employment outlook for Baristas in Bayonne is positive, with a job growth rate of about 6% per year, indicating a growing demand for skilled professionals in this role within the local coffee and beverage industry.
How Much Does a Barista Make in Bayonne, NJ?
The salary of a Barista in Bayonne varies according to experience and skill level. The following table outlines estimated wages for different experience levels.
| Experience level | Hourly pay | Weekly pay | Monthly pay | Yearly pay |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Entry-level (~25th percentile) | $13.00 | $520.00 | $2,253.33 | $27,040.00 |
| Mid-level (average) | $14.00 | $560.00 | $2,426.67 | $29,120.00 |
| Top earners (90th percentile) | $15.00 | $600.00 | $2,600.00 | $31,200.00 |
Do Baristas in Bayonne Earn Tips?
Yes, Baristas in Bayonne frequently earn additional income through tips. On average, they can make an extra $5 to $10 per hour in tips, significantly boosting their overall earnings, especially in busy coffee shops and specialty cafes.
Barista Salary in Bayonne vs. National Average
Nationally, Baristas earn an average of around $14.00 per hour, which converts to about $29,120 per year.
Compared to the national average, Baristas in Bayonne make slightly more, with an hourly rate of $14.23 and an annual salary of approximately $29,598.40. This slight increase may be influenced by the local cost of living and demand for Baristas in the region.

What Influences a Barista’s Salary in Bayonne?
The salary of a Barista in Bayonne depends on several key factors:
- Experience and Skill Level: Baristas with advanced skills in specialty coffee preparation and customer service tend to earn more.
- Type of Establishment: Working at high-end cafes or branded coffee shops often comes with higher pay compared to fast-food or casual outlets.
- Certification and Training: Completing recognized barista training programs and certifications can enhance earning potential.
- Shift Hours: Evening or weekend shifts may provide shift differentials increasing overall wages.
- Local Business Demand: Areas with a high concentration of cafes and specialty shops may offer more competitive salaries.

Establishments That Baristas in Bayonne Work At
Baristas find employment in a wide range of establishments, including:
- Specialty Coffee Shops: These establishments often pay higher wages due to the emphasis on quality and barista skills.
- Café Chains: Chain coffee shops like Starbucks offer stable employment with opportunities for advancement.
- Casual and Fast-Casual Restaurants: May employ Baristas as part of their beverage service, generally with lower pay than specialty shops.
- Hotels and Event Venues: Provide seasonal or full-time employment, often with tips and slightly higher pay.
The type of establishment directly affects salary levels, with specialty and branded coffee shops typically providing the best compensation for Baristas.
